Ingenia Communities ASX update: 18 communities now being built

1 min read

The ASX-listed owner and operator of land lease communities, all-age rental communities, seniors rental villages and holiday parks has updated shareholders with good and bad news.

The good news is that Ingenia Communities’ construction woes appear to have abated. 18 communities are now being built, with construction started at the 606-home site in Morriset on the NSW Central Coast and the 122-home community at Fullerton Cove, Newcastle, NSW.

However, the continual raising of interest rates is making buyers hesitant, and it is hurting sales, with Ingenia Communities being on track to sell around 370 units in FY23, at the bottom of the original target of 370-420 sales in the full financial year.


Ingenia Communities signified it has the potential to add additional rental homes to existing communities to meet demand. Its all-age rental communities are full, and CEO Simon Owen (pictured) has publicly spoken about the unmet need for this type of accommodation.

It expects to add around 70 new rental homes in FY23 and up to 100 more in FY24 with demand expected to grow.

Ingenia has acquired a 10ha site next to its 190-home Ingenia Lifestyle Plantations community at Woolgoolga on the NSW mid North Coast for another 170 homes.
